A Second Hodgepodge Coffeehouse Opens Friday in Reynoldstown

The petite version of the popular East Atlanta coffee shop opens just down the road on Moreland

The second location of Hodgepodge Coffeehouse opens Friday, April 19 at 1 Moreland Avenue in Reynoldstown, with a grand opening set for Saturday.

Unlike the original location up the road in East Atlanta, the Reynoldstown shop is much smaller — what owner Krystle Rodriguez dubs a “Hodgepodge express” at only 900-square-feet. She expects it to act as more of a grab-and-go location but, a ten-seat community table equipped with power outlets and two four-top tables are available inside. A six-seat laptop bar is also in the works and should be completed next week.

As for the menu, there’s a full selection of coffee and baked goods as well as bagels from Emerald City Bagel.

“Seven years ago, we were opening 720 [Moreland Avenue] and had no idea what direction this adventure was heading. I couldn’t even fathom the idea of another location,” Rodriguez tells Eater Atlanta. “But, we’ve had such amazing support from our community and the city, and we have such a phenomenal staff. We can’t wait to spread the love to the other side of I-20.”

A third Hodgepodge location opens in Summerhill on Hank Aaron Drive in 2021.

Monday - Saturday, 7 a.m. to 3 p.m.; Sunday, 8 a.m. to 3 p.m.

1 Moreland Avenue SE, Suite C, Atlanta. hodgepodgecoffee.com.
